在当今快节奏的IT领域,容器编排系统如Kubernetes已经成为管理大规模应用程序的首选。然而,当我们讨论容器中工作负载的重启和终止时,一个关键概念往往被忽略——优雅关闭。

优雅关闭是指系统在终止一个进程时,让其有机会完成正在进行的工作,清理资源并做一些必要的清理操作。在Kubernetes中,优雅关闭显得尤为重要。

为什么呢?因为在容器内运行的应用程序可能需要一些时间来完成正在进行的任务,例如数据的写入或处理。如果容器突然被终止,这些任务可能会被中断,导致数据丢失或者资源泄漏。

优雅关闭机制可以让容器内的应用程序在接收到终止信号后,进行必要的清理操作,确保数据的完整性和资源的正常释放。这不仅可以提高系统的稳定性,还可以减少由于不正确的终止而导致的问题。

因此,作为一名Kubernetes用户,我们应该重视容器内应用程序的优雅关闭。通过正确配置容器的终止信号处理和适当的资源清理操作,我们可以确保系统的可靠性,提升用户体验。

让我们一起努力,让优雅关闭成为我们在Kubernetes中工作时必不可少的一环。让我们向着更加稳定和可靠的应用程序迈进!

详情参考

了解更多有趣的事情:https://blog.ds3783.com/